What I have noticed is that a lot of ToO strategies call for the tank to pick up (and kite) particular mobs that are not always in the same region. Most of our threat skills are AoE so being able to cherry-pick individual targets at range is pretty tough. More ranged, single target threat building skills (like Fray the Edge) would be really handy. If that is a "pull in" skill then /signed.
